The National league...

Is it fair to say it’s basically Div 5 now? Not really “non league” as we’ve always termed it. A lot of the clubs have been in the EFL, crowds are generally decent. And there’s 2 up 2 down every year.

Are most clubs there full time now?
All bar a few now I think - Maidenhead, Wealdstone, Dorking and Oxford City are the only ones that come to mind for this season that are part-time. Two of them make up the bottom two, and the other two are still fighting for their lives. It's a hard slog to compete at that level now!
